Understanding How Roofing Systems Are Built
A complete roofing system is made up of multiple layers, each serving a specific purpose. The outermost layer, such as shingles, tiles, or metal sheets, acts as the first barrier against external weather conditions.
Below this surface layer is the underlayment, which provides additional waterproofing and protects the structure from moisture infiltration. Flashing is installed around joints, vents, and chimneys to prevent leaks in vulnerable areas.
The roof deck serves as the structural foundation, supporting all other layers. Proper ventilation systems are also integrated to regulate temperature and moisture levels, preventing condensation and mold growth.
When all these components are installed correctly, the roofing system works as a unified structure that delivers long-term durability and protection. This is why professional roof installation is essential for ensuring system integrity.
Importance of Proper Roof Design Before Installation
Before any roofing work begins, proper planning and design are required. Load calculations must be performed to ensure that the structure can support the chosen roofing materials.
The slope or pitch of the roof plays a key role in water drainage and overall performance. Incorrect slope design can lead to water pooling, which increases the risk of leaks and structural damage.
Material selection is also an important part of the design process. Different materials offer varying levels of durability, energy efficiency, and weather resistance.
Proper planning ensures that roof installation is tailored to the building’s specific needs, improving performance and extending lifespan.
Step-by-Step Roof Installation Process
The roof installation process involves several carefully coordinated steps that must be completed with precision.
The first step is preparation, which includes removing old roofing materials if necessary and inspecting the underlying structure for damage. Any issues with the roof deck must be repaired before new materials are installed.
Next, underlayment is applied across the roof surface to create a waterproof barrier. This layer is essential for protecting the structure from moisture infiltration.
After this, flashing is installed around chimneys, vents, and roof edges to seal vulnerable areas.
The outer roofing material is then installed, whether shingles, tiles, or metal panels, starting from the bottom and working upward to ensure proper overlap and water shedding.
Finally, ridge caps and finishing components are installed, and the entire system is inspected for alignment, sealing, and structural integrity.
A properly executed roof installation ensures long-term durability and reliable performance under all weather conditions.
Common Installation Mistakes and Their Consequences
Improper installation can lead to serious problems that affect both performance and safety. One of the most common mistakes is incorrect nailing or fastening, which can cause materials to loosen over time.
Poor alignment of shingles or panels can lead to gaps that allow water infiltration.
Inadequate sealing around flashing areas is another frequent issue that results in leaks.
Using low-quality materials or skipping essential layers such as underlayment can significantly reduce roof lifespan.
These mistakes highlight the importance of professional expertise during roof installation to ensure long-term protection.
Early Signs of Installation Issues
Even after installation, certain signs may indicate problems with the roofing system. Water stains on ceilings or walls often suggest leaks caused by improper sealing.
Uneven or loose roofing materials may indicate poor fastening techniques.Sagging roof sections can point to structural issues or improper load distribution.
Higher energy bills may suggest insulation problems caused by installation errors.Addressing these issues early helps prevent more serious damage and costly repairs.
Importance of Maintenance After Installation
Even a properly installed roof requires regular maintenance to ensure long-term performance. Routine inspections help identify minor issues before they develop into major problems.
Cleaning gutters and removing debris prevents water buildup and structural strain.Checking flashing and seals ensures that vulnerable areas remain protected.
Seasonal inspections are especially important after storms or extreme weather events.Regular maintenance helps preserve the effectiveness of roof installation and extends the life of the entire roofing system.
